Top 5 Motorcycle Games on Android in Italy Q4 2021
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 motorcycle games on Android in Italy during Q4 2021, including down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the fourth quarter of 2021, the top 5 motorcycle games on the Android platform in Italy displayed varied performance trends in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at how each game fared.
Real Bike Racing from Italic Games started the quarter with weekly downloads of around 6.3K, peaking at 9.3K in mid-October, before gradually declining to approximately 3.5K by the end of December. The game saw its highest weekly revenue of about $21 in early November. Active users peaked at around 28K in late October but declined to approximately 10.5K by the end of the quarter.
MotoGP Racing '23 by WePlay Media LLC experienced a significant increase in weekly downloads, starting at around 693 and reaching a peak of nearly 12.1K by the end of November. Weekly revenue peaked at about $276 in mid-November. Active users also saw a substantial rise, peaking at approximately 14.5K in late November before settling at around 7.6K by the end of December.
Xtreme Motorbikes from Xtreme Games Studio had varying weekly downloads, starting at around 1K and peaking at 10.6K in early November. The game’s weekly revenue reached its peak of about $34 in early November. Active users peaked at approximately 22.4K in early November, with a slight decline to around 12.3K by the end of December.
Summer Wheelie by Bad Idea Studio saw a peak in weekly downloads of around 3.1K at the beginning of the quarter, with a low of approximately 588 downloads in late November, and rose again to about 2.7K in mid-December. Active users peaked at around 8.6K in late September but declined to approximately 5.6K by the end of December.
Ricky Zoom™ from Entertainment One had a steady increase in weekly downloads, starting at around 1.2K and peaking at approximately 1.9K by the end of December. Weekly revenue reached its highest point of about $25 in mid-December. Active users saw a gradual increase, peaking at around 2.7K by the end of the quarter.
